Abstract:
In this study, the significant role of epistemological moral skepticism in the overall context of the philosophical schools, and the types of arguments and criticism on the part of the study will be discussed. The importance and aim of this study which has been done through library research, is to check the exact types and attributes of the epistemological moral skepticism, and some of its arguments along with the criticisms posed against it. Epistemological moral skepticism, as ultra-moral view, investigates and critically discusses the moral knowledge. Academic moral skepticism and pyrhonie moral skepticism are two subcategories of Epistemological moral skepticism. Academic moral skepticism presenting arguments such as regress argument and other skeptical assumptions concludes that none of us has moral knowledge since none of our cognitions is supported by complete, positive and magnified perception. But pyrhonie skepticism suspends the sentences and claims that we do not know whether our beliefs are justified or not? The decision to admit or deny the existence of justified beliefs, may encounter some defects that we cannot avoid.
